Kill Your Darlings
L. E. Harper
$13.99An author seeks refuge from brutal depression by writing within her own fantasy world. But then she wakes up in it! And she's able to hang out with people she cares about (and created). This set-up--combining the fantasy-writer ideal with escape & depression--is exactly the type of book writers, creatives, and outsiders will cling to. Heed the content warning though!

You Are Here
Karin Lin-Greenberg
$27.00 $25.11Small town friendship fiction is a genre I'll sign up for any day of the week. Set it in a mall, and I'm even further in. Have you been to the mall recently? The storefronts are ghost-towns, and the grandparents are getting in cardio. There are stories abound, and You Are Here captures it.

What You Don't Know Will Make a Whole New World: A Memoir
Dorothy Lazard
$20.00 $18.60This debut is from one of California's most celebrated librarians and public historians. It's the story of coming of age in the Bay Area in the 60s and 70s and the author's thirst for knowledge on her way to becoming "the queen of [her] own nerdy domain ."
